significant cyber incident
Defined in 2 places across 2 titles of the United States Code.
Significant cyber incident.—The term "significant cyber incident" means a cyber incident, or a group of related cyber incidents, that the Administrator determines is likely to result in demonstrable harm to the national airspace system of the United States.

The term "significant cyber incident" means a cyber incident, or a group of related cyber incidents, that the Secretary determines is likely to result in demonstrable harm to the national security interests, foreign relations, or economy of the United States or to the public confidence, civil liberties, or public health and safety of the people of the United States.
